Constructed of a silvered zink alloy, the obverse bearing a central raised German national eagle clutching an HJ insignia, within a ribbed ring bearing an inscription of BLUT UND EHRE (BLOOD AND HONOUR), the reverse with a bar and swivel attachment prongs, marked with a Reichszeugmeisterei (RZM) logo and maker code M4 42 for Hermann Aurich, Dresden, also bearing the remnants of an RZM label, measuring 64 mm (w) x 48 mm (h), with
